Mandi Chapa is a Lecturer at Rice University's School of Architecture and practices architecture and urban design at Huitt-Zollars (formerly Morris Architects). She leads the Houston downtown urban planning team, focusing on projects such as Livable Centers studies for downtown Houston, North Houston, Galveston, Rosenberg, and Dallas transit studies. Her work emphasizes design, metrics, equity, and community outreach to build resilient communities.
Education:
- B.Arch., University of Houston
- B.EnvD., University of Houston
Current Teaching: ARCH 350: Urban Transportation.
Professional Projects: Managed projects including the Interstate-45 redevelopment public engagement process, greenway planning, street design manuals, and equity-focused urban initiatives.
